Searched refs:vlan_mode (Results 1 – 12 of 12) sorted by relevance
98 sc->vlan_mode == 0) { in ip175d_hw_setup()157 sc->vlan_mode = mode; in ip175d_set_vlan_mode()160 sc->vlan_mode = mode; in ip175d_set_vlan_mode()168 sc->vlan_mode = 0; in ip175d_set_vlan_mode()172 if (sc->vlan_mode != 0) { in ip175d_set_vlan_mode()188 ip17x_reset_vlans(sc, sc->vlan_mode); in ip175d_set_vlan_mode()203 return (sc->vlan_mode); in ip175d_get_vlan_mode()
59 ip17x_reset_vlans(struct ip17x_softc *sc, uint32_t vlan_mode) in ip17x_reset_vlans() argument72 if (vlan_mode == ETHERSWITCH_VLAN_PORT) { in ip17x_reset_vlans()88 } else if (vlan_mode == ETHERSWITCH_VLAN_DOT1Q) { in ip17x_reset_vlans()149 if (sc->vlan_mode == 0) in ip17x_setvgroup()158 if (sc->vlan_mode == ETHERSWITCH_VLAN_DOT1Q) { in ip17x_setvgroup()
183 switch (sc->vlan_mode) { in ip175c_hw_setup()205 sc->vlan_mode = mode; in ip175c_set_vlan_mode()211 sc->vlan_mode = ETHERSWITCH_VLAN_PORT; in ip175c_set_vlan_mode()216 ip17x_reset_vlans(sc, sc->vlan_mode); in ip175c_set_vlan_mode()231 return (sc->vlan_mode); in ip175c_get_vlan_mode()
66 uint32_t vlan_mode; /* VLAN mode */ member
432 if (sc->vlan_mode == ETHERSWITCH_VLAN_DOT1Q) { in ip17x_setport()546 conf->vlan_mode = sc->hal.ip17x_get_vlan_mode(sc); in ip17x_getconf()560 sc->hal.ip17x_set_vlan_mode(sc, conf->vlan_mode); in ip17x_setconf()
202 if (sc->vlan_mode == ETHERSWITCH_VLAN_DOT1Q) { in ar8xxx_reset_vlans()230 } else if (sc->vlan_mode == ETHERSWITCH_VLAN_PORT) { in ar8xxx_reset_vlans()289 switch (sc->vlan_mode) { in ar8xxx_getvgroup()318 if (sc->vlan_mode == 0) in ar8xxx_setvgroup()327 if (sc->vlan_mode == ETHERSWITCH_VLAN_DOT1Q && in ar8xxx_setvgroup()339 if (sc->vlan_mode == ETHERSWITCH_VLAN_DOT1Q) { in ar8xxx_setvgroup()351 switch (sc->vlan_mode) { in ar8xxx_setvgroup()
221 sc->vlan_mode = ETHERSWITCH_VLAN_DOT1Q; in arswitch_set_vlan_mode()224 sc->vlan_mode = ETHERSWITCH_VLAN_PORT; in arswitch_set_vlan_mode()227 sc->vlan_mode = 0; in arswitch_set_vlan_mode()741 if (sc->vlan_mode == ETHERSWITCH_VLAN_DOT1Q) { in arswitch_setport()804 conf->vlan_mode = sc->vlan_mode; in arswitch_getconf()819 err = arswitch_set_vlan_mode(sc, conf->vlan_mode); in arswitch_setconf()
74 uint32_t vlan_mode; member
863 if (sc->vlan_mode == ETHERSWITCH_VLAN_PORT) { in ar8327_reset_vlans()869 } else if (sc->vlan_mode == ETHERSWITCH_VLAN_DOT1Q) { in ar8327_reset_vlans()908 if (sc->vlan_mode == ETHERSWITCH_VLAN_DOT1Q) { in ar8327_reset_vlans()
375 conf.vlan_mode = ETHERSWITCH_VLAN_ISL; in set_vlan_mode()377 conf.vlan_mode = ETHERSWITCH_VLAN_PORT; in set_vlan_mode()379 conf.vlan_mode = ETHERSWITCH_VLAN_DOT1Q; in set_vlan_mode()381 conf.vlan_mode = ETHERSWITCH_VLAN_DOT1Q_4K; in set_vlan_mode()383 conf.vlan_mode = ETHERSWITCH_VLAN_DOUBLE_TAG; in set_vlan_mode()385 conf.vlan_mode = 0; in set_vlan_mode()405 switch (cfg->conf.vlan_mode) { in print_config()441 if (cfg->conf.vlan_mode == ETHERSWITCH_VLAN_DOT1Q) in print_port()480 if (cfg->conf.vlan_mode == ETHERSWITCH_VLAN_PORT) in print_vlangroup()
53 uint32_t vlan_mode; /* Switch VLAN mode */ member
678 conf->vlan_mode = ETHERSWITCH_VLAN_DOT1Q; in rtl_getconf()